Patch level : 10.0 patch 238

Files correlati     : lv0300a.msk
Ricompilazione Demo : [ ]
Commento            :
aggiunta gestione depositi nel magazzino


git-svn-id: svn://10.65.10.50/trunk@18248 c028cbd2-c16b-5b4b-a496-9718f37d4682
This commit is contained in:
luca83 2009-02-11 16:58:11 +00:00
parent 93903b19b7
commit f13db7efb2
2 changed files with 62 additions and 35 deletions

View File

@ -38,25 +38,27 @@
#define F_CAUSLAV 223 #define F_CAUSLAV 223
#define F_CAUSLAVDESC 224 #define F_CAUSLAVDESC 224
#define F_CODMAGN 225 #define F_CODMAG 225
#define F_DESMAGN 226 #define F_DESMAG 226
#define F_CODMAGC 227 #define F_CODMAGN 227
#define F_DESMAGC 228 #define F_DESMAGN 228
#define F_CODMAGC 229
#define F_DESMAGC 230
#define F_PATH_CON 229 #define F_PATH_CON 231
#define F_PATH_MAN 230 #define F_PATH_MAN 232
#define F_PATH_LAVA 231 #define F_PATH_LAVA 233
#define F_UNICONT 232 #define F_UNICONT 234
#define F_AUTGIRI 233 #define F_AUTGIRI 235
#define F_DATAFISSA 234 #define F_DATAFISSA 236
#define F_AGGCONG 235 #define F_AGGCONG 237
#define F_PERARR 236 #define F_PERARR 238
#define F_RIFOR 237 #define F_RIFOR 239
#define F_ARTCANFIS 238 #define F_ARTCANFIS 240
#define F_GESTSACA 239 #define F_GESTSACA 241
#define F_ALMANAC 240 #define F_ALMANAC 242
#define F_USEINDSP 241 #define F_USEINDSP 243
#define S_CODNUM_RIT 101 #define S_CODNUM_RIT 101
#define S_TIPODOC_RIT 102 #define S_TIPODOC_RIT 102

View File

@ -415,18 +415,41 @@ BEGIN
PROMPT 1 1 "@bMagazzini" PROMPT 1 1 "@bMagazzini"
END END
STRING F_CODMAGN 4 STRING F_CODMAG 4
BEGIN BEGIN
PROMPT 2 2 "Magazzino del nuovo " PROMPT 2 2 "Magazzino "
FIELD CODMAG
USE MAG SELECT CODTAB[4,5]==""
FLAG "U"
INPUT CODTAB F_CODMAG
DISPLAY "Codice " CODTAB[1,3]
DISPLAY "Denominazione mag.@50 " S0
OUTPUT F_CODMAG CODTAB[1,3]
OUTPUT F_DESMAG S0
CHECKTYPE REQUIRED
FLAGS "UPA"
END
STRING F_DESMAG 50
BEGIN
PROMPT 20 2 ""
FLAGS "D"
END
STRING F_CODMAGN 3
BEGIN
PROMPT 2 3 "Dep. nuovo "
HELP "Codice deposito del nuovo" HELP "Codice deposito del nuovo"
FIELD CODMAGN FIELD CODMAGN
KEY 1 KEY 1
USE MAG SELECT CODTAB[4,5]=="" USE MAG
FLAG "U" INPUT CODTAB[1,3] F_CODMAG SELECT
INPUT CODTAB F_CODMAGN INPUT CODTAB[4,5] F_CODMAGN
DISPLAY "Codice " CODTAB[1,3] DISPLAY "Cod. magazzino" CODTAB[1,3]
DISPLAY "Denominazione mag.@50 " S0 DISPLAY "Cod. deposito" CODTAB[4,5]
OUTPUT F_CODMAGN CODTAB[1,3] DISPLAY "Denominazione dep.@50" S0
OUTPUT F_CODMAG CODTAB[1,3]
OUTPUT F_CODMAGN CODTAB[4,5]
OUTPUT F_DESMAGN S0 OUTPUT F_DESMAGN S0
CHECKTYPE REQUIRED CHECKTYPE REQUIRED
FLAGS "UPA" FLAGS "UPA"
@ -434,23 +457,25 @@ END
STRING F_DESMAGN 50 STRING F_DESMAGN 50
BEGIN BEGIN
PROMPT 2 3 " " PROMPT 20 3 ""
HELP "Descrizione Magazzino" HELP "Descrizione Magazzino"
FLAGS "D" FLAGS "D"
END END
STRING F_CODMAGC 4 STRING F_CODMAGC 3
BEGIN BEGIN
PROMPT 2 4 "Magazzino del circolante " PROMPT 2 4 "Dep. circ. "
HELP "Codice deposito del circolante" HELP "Codice deposito del circolante"
FIELD CODMAGC FIELD CODMAGC
KEY 1 KEY 1
USE MAG SELECT CODTAB[4,5]=="" USE MAG
FLAG "U" INPUT CODTAB[1,3] F_CODMAG SELECT
INPUT CODTAB F_CODMAGC INPUT CODTAB[4,5] F_CODMAGC
DISPLAY "Codice " CODTAB[1,3] DISPLAY "Cod. magazzino" CODTAB[1,3]
DISPLAY "Denominazione mag.@50 " S0 DISPLAY "Cod. deposito" CODTAB[4,5]
OUTPUT F_CODMAGC CODTAB[1,3] DISPLAY "Denominazione dep.@50" S0
OUTPUT F_CODMAG CODTAB[1,3]
OUTPUT F_CODMAGC CODTAB[4,5]
OUTPUT F_DESMAGC S0 OUTPUT F_DESMAGC S0
CHECKTYPE REQUIRED CHECKTYPE REQUIRED
FLAGS "UPA" FLAGS "UPA"
@ -458,7 +483,7 @@ END
STRING F_DESMAGC 50 STRING F_DESMAGC 50
BEGIN BEGIN
PROMPT 2 5 " " PROMPT 20 4 ""
HELP "Descrizione Magazzino" HELP "Descrizione Magazzino"
FLAGS "D" FLAGS "D"
END END